Natural Resources Depletion: Meaning, Types, Facts, Causes, Effects and Solutions
Natural Resources Depletion Natural resource depletion refers to the decreasing amount of resources left on the Planet Earth. It occurs when we use the resources at a rate faster than their renewal. It is indeed a very grave problem nowadays. Why is Natural Resource Depletion a Problem? In ancient times, human life was very close … Continue reading Natural Resources Depletion: Meaning, Types, Facts, Causes, Effects and Solutions
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ed